## Step 4: Move the watering scheduler over

Welcome aboard! Next up is SproutClock, our plant-watering scheduler. It decides when each greenhouse zone at the Fernley site gets a soak, so don't skip this one. Stop the old cron jobs first, then copy the settings into the new host before restarting. Here are the configuration values the service expects on startup.

service settings:
[ulair]
team = praath
access_code = ac_06d704
owner = wenix.ulair
host = ulair.qirvancorp.corp
port = 9200
peer = sorys.nelvronet.internal
salt = 2668132c
pin = 9140

Subject: Cron drift investigation — Quartzline scheduler

Team, I've traced the intermittent drift in the Quartzline nightly jobs to a clock-sync race on the Harwick cluster: the scheduler reads wall time before the NTP correction lands, so jobs fire up to 40 seconds early. The fix pins scheduling to monotonic offsets and re-syncs on lease renewal. Please review the diff carefully before we cut the candidate. The token for the patched build follows.

trace token, fajep-yagep: htk31_9f84d966d50d2e729c799259be7496d

Subject: On-call handover — resizeler CLI

Hi Marek,

Handing over on-call for the resizeler batch image-resizing CLI. Quiet week: one OOM on oversized TIFF inputs, mitigated by the 512MB per-worker cap shipped Tuesday. Note for the security review: input paths are now canonicalized before the chroot, and the temp directory is mode 0700. No open incidents. If anything about the sandboxing changes needs clarification during the review, contact the tooling team at the address below.

alerts address for bajop-yahog: istwyn@lumiclabs.internal